About P. Pandikumar

P. Pandikumar is a scholar working on Plant Science, Molecular Biology, Pharmacology, Complementary and alternative medicine and Epidemiology, having authored 47 papers that have together received 1.1k indexed citations. Recurring topics across this work include Ethnobotanical and Medicinal Plants Studies (7 papers), Liver Disease Diagnosis and Treatment (5 papers), Phytochemistry and Biological Activities (5 papers), Phytochemicals and Antioxidant Activities (4 papers), Natural product bioactivities and synthesis (4 papers), Pharmacological Effects of Natural Compounds (4 papers), Natural Antidiabetic Agents Studies (4 papers) and Insect Pest Control Strategies (3 papers). The work is most often cited by research in Complementary and alternative medicine (167 citations), Pharmacology (171 citations), Plant Science (429 citations), Toxicology (32 citations) and Food Science (170 citations). P. Pandikumar has collaborated with scholars based in India, Saudi Arabia and United States. Frequent co-authors include S. Ignacimuthu, Muthiah Chellappandian, S. Mutheeswaran, Michael Gabriel Paulraj, Naïf Abdullah Al-Dhabi, K. Balakrishna, Krishnaraj Thirugnanasambantham, S. Saravanan, Veeramuthu Duraipandiyan and Antony Stalin. Their work appears in journals such as Journal of Ethnopharmacology, Biomedicine & Pharmacotherapy, Experimental Parasitology, European Journal of Pharmacology and Biocatalysis and Agricultural Biotechnology.
